Yeah, so, I mean, it's certified used vehicles from Ford initially.
Hyundai does new vehicles through Amazon.
And, yeah, it is your very familiar, you know, add to my cart kind of Amazon experience.
You can do the financing.
You can browse the site and pick your car.
And then you pick it up from a dealer.
You do the final paperwork at the dealer.
You can do a test drive at the dealer if you'd like to as well.
Yeah, I mean, they are Amazon, right?
So if they really get into this and that is their goal, they could become a very significant player.
So you saw those two, Carvana and CarMax, dropped initially on the news, although Carvana is back up again.
So, you know, I think it does stimulate interest in the category of online car buying, which a lot of consumers, you know, it sounds good to them because it reduces the hassle, reduces the time.
